Coppin Graduate Programs Overview

Coppin State University (referred to as Coppin) is a Public, 4-years school located in Baltimore, MD. Coppin offers total 20 graduate programs through Master's, Doctorate, Post-graduate certificate degree/programs.
The 2023 graduate tuition & fees at Coppin State University is $8,370 for Maryland residents and $14,058 for out-of-state students when a student attends full-time status. The tuition per credit hour is $358 for Maryland residents and $659 for out-of-state students. Total 249 students have enrolled in graduate programs where the school has total population of 2,006 with undergraduate students.

Who Accredits Coppin State University

Coppin State University is accredited by Middle States Commission on Higher Education (1/1/1962 - Current).

2023 Graduate Tuition & Fees

For academic year 2022-2023, the average tuition & fees of Coppin graduate programs is $8,370 for Maryland residents and $14,058 for other students. The tuition per credit hour for graduate program is $358 for Maryland residents and $659 for other students. The average living costs is $15,132 when a student lives on campus housing.

Graduate Student Population

At Coppin graduate schools, there are total 249 graduate students. Among them, 34 students have enrolled graduate programs online exclusively. By gender, there are 62 men and 187 women students at Coppin graduate schools. Next table summarizes the graduate student population at Coppin.
